다음을 통해 공유


Get-PSSnapin

컴퓨터의 Windows PowerShell 스냅인을 가져옵니다.

구문

Get-PSSnapin [[-Name] <string[]>] [-Registered] [<CommonParameters>]

설명

Get-PSSnapin cmdlet은 현재 세션에 추가되었거나 시스템에 등록된 Windows PowerShell 스냅인을 가져옵니다. 스냅인은 검색되는 순서대로 나열됩니다.

Get-PSSnapin은 등록된 스냅인만 가져옵니다. Windows PowerShell 스냅인을 등록하려면 Microsoft .NET Framework 2.0에 포함된 InstallUtil 도구를 사용합니다. 자세한 내용은 MSDN(Microsoft Developer Network) 라이브러리의 "How to Register Cmdlets, Providers, and Host Applications(cmdlet, 공급자 및 호스트 응용 프로그램을 등록하는 방법)"(https://go.microsoft.com/fwlink/?LinkId=143619)를 참조하십시오.

매개 변수

-Name <string[]>

지정된 Windows PowerShell 스냅인만 가져옵니다. 하나 이상의 Windows PowerShell 스냅인 이름을 입력하십시오. 와일드카드를 사용할 수 있습니다.

매개 변수 이름("Name")은 선택 사항입니다.

필수 여부

false

위치

1

기본값

파이프라인 입력 적용 여부

false

와일드카드 문자 적용 여부

false

-Registered

세션에 아직 추가되지 않은 경우에도 시스템에 등록된 Windows PowerShell 스냅인을 가져옵니다.

Windows PowerShell과 함께 설치된 스냅인은 이 목록에 나타나지 않습니다.

이 매개 변수가 없는 경우 Get-PSSnapin은 세션에 추가된 Windows PowerShell 스냅인을 가져옵니다.

필수 여부

false

위치

named

기본값

파이프라인 입력 적용 여부

false

와일드카드 문자 적용 여부

false

<CommonParameters>

이 cmdlet은 -Verbose, -Debug, -ErrorAction, -ErrorVariable, -OutBuffer, -OutVariable 등의 일반 매개 변수를 지원합니다. 자세한 내용은 about_commonparameters.

입력 및 출력

입력 유형은 cmdlet으로 파이프할 수 있는 개체의 유형입니다. 반환 유형은 cmdlet에서 반환되는 개체의 유형입니다.

입력

없음

입력을 Get-PSSnapin으로 파이프할 수 없습니다.

출력

System.Management.Automation.PSSnapInInfo

Get-PSSnapin은 가져오는 각 스냅인에 대한 개체를 반환합니다.

참고

기본 제공 별칭("psnp")으로 Get-PSSnapin을 참조할 수 있습니다. 자세한 내용은 about_Aliases를 참조하십시오.

예 1

C:\PS>get-PSSnapIn

설명
-----------
이 명령은 세션에 현재 로드된 Windows PowerShell 스냅인을 가져옵니다. 여기에는 Windows PowerShell과 함께 설치된 스냅인과 세션에 추가된 스냅인이 포함됩니다.





예 2

C:\PS>get-PSSnapIn -registered

설명
-----------
이 명령은 세션에 이미 추가된 스냅인을 비롯하여 컴퓨터에 등록된 Windows PowerShell 스냅인을 가져옵니다. Windows PowerShell과 함께 설치된 스냅인이나 시스템에 아직 등록되지 않은 Windows PowerShell 스냅인 DLL(동적 연결 라이브러리)은 출력에 포함되지 않습니다.





예 3

C:\PS>get-PSSnapIn smp*

설명
-----------
이 명령은 현재 세션에서 이름이 "smp"로 시작하는 Windows PowerShell 스냅인을 가져옵니다.





참고 항목

개념

Add-PSSnapin
Remove-PSSnapin